"There was not a drop to spare!" - Joey Logano reflects on his Ally 400 win
Joey Logano won the Ally 400 with not a drop a gas to spare after a record fiv🃏e overtime attempts.

Joey Logano secured his spot in the 2024 NASCAR Cup Series Playoffs last night wi𝔍th a win in the Ally 400 at the Nashville Sup🍸erspeedway.
The two-time Champion risked it al🐈l as he stayed out for a record five Overtime attempts as he was running his Ford on near empty the entire time. Luckily for Logano and the #22 crew, their bravery worked out and they got the much-needed win.
Afte♏r the race, Logano was asked about his feelings about finally getting a race win to secure his way into the 2024 Playoffs:
“This was pure exc🦩itement. Let’s be honest we were mediocre today we were not the fastest car by all means, but Paul’s strategies worked really well throughout most of ꦇthe race, and we just stayed aggressive, and it worked out.”
Logano continued by statin𝓀g that he was praying that his Team Penske Ford would reach the finish line:
“I did not feel good about it, I can tell you that much. You just have to cross your fingers and say a prayer and hope ▨that there is enough gas in it. I can tell you what there was not a drop to spare!”
